Publication number: 20260164940Abstract: A display device includes a substrate including a light emitting area and a non-light emitting area; an anode electrode disposed on one surface of the substrate to overlap the light emitting area; a light emitting layer disposed on the anode electrode; an element insulating layer disposed on the light emitting layer and defining an opening; a cathode electrode disposed on the element insulating layer and in contact with the light emitting layer in a portion overlapping the opening; and an insulating pattern disposed to surround the opening in a plan view and disposed between the light emitting layer and the element insulating layer, where the insulating pattern includes a bending portion bent in a direction perpendicular to the one surface of the substrate.Type: ApplicationFiled: August 19, 2025Publication date: June 11, 2026Inventors: Sa Min LEE, A Rong KIM, Young Min MOON, Won Je CHO

Publication number: 20260130091Abstract: A display device includes: a substrate on which first to third sub-pixels are defined; sidewalls disposed on the substrate; an anode electrode disposed on the substrate to correspond to the first to third sub-pixels; a first emission structure disposed on the anode electrode of the first sub-pixel; a second emission structure disposed on the anode electrode of the second sub-pixel; a third emission structure disposed on the anode electrode of the third sub-pixel; a cathode electrode disposed on the first emission structure, the second emission structure, and the third emission structure; and a capping layer disposed on the cathode electrode. Each of the sidewalls includes: a first sidewall; and a second sidewall disposed on the first sidewall, and having a width greater than a width of the first sidewall. The capping layer does not overlap at least one of the first to third emission structures in a plan view.Type: ApplicationFiled: July 30, 2025Publication date: May 7, 2026Inventors: Hee Min PARK, A Rong KIM, Jae Ik KIM, Young Min MOON, Hee Jun YANG, Sa Min LEE, Won Je CHO

Patent number: 11653524Abstract: A display device includes a substrate including a plastic layer, a barrier layer, and a display area in which an image is displayed. The display device further includes a light-emitting diode disposed in the display area, a planarization layer, and a pixel definition layer. The planarization layer and the pixel definition layer overlap the light-emitting diode. The display device further includes a thin film encapsulation layer disposed on the pixel definition layer. The thin film encapsulation layer includes at least one inorganic layer. The display device further includes an opening disposed in the display area and penetrating the substrate. The opening includes a protruded portion and a depressed portion, and the barrier layer overlaps at least one of the pixel definition layer and the planarization layer at the protruded portion.Type: GrantFiled: March 29, 2021Date of Patent: May 16, 2023Assignee: SAMSUNG DISPLAY CO., LTD.Inventors: Seung Ho Yoon, Woo Yong Sung, Won Je Cho, Won Woo Choi

Patent number: 10790475Abstract: A display device includes: a substrate; pixels on the substrate; and a polarization film on the pixels and stretched in a first direction and a second direction opposite to the first direction. The polarization film is cut at an end portion of the polarization film along a third direction, the third direction forming an acute angle with the first direction toward an outside of the polarization film.Type: GrantFiled: July 12, 2019Date of Patent: September 29, 2020Assignee: Samsung Display Co., Ltd.Inventor: Won Je Cho

Patent number: 10779400Abstract: A display device includes a flexible substrate including a bending area corresponding to an area at which the display device is bent, and a first area and a second area which is spaced apart from the first area by the bending area, a display element unit disposed in the first area of the flexible substrate; and a buffer member disposed in the bending area of the flexible substrate. The buffer member in the bending area includes: a first buffer member having a first maximum thickness, and a second buffer member having a second maximum thickness which is smaller than the first maximum thickness. Among the first buffer member and the second member, the first buffer member disposed closer to the first area and the second member disposed closer to the second area.Type: GrantFiled: April 20, 2020Date of Patent: September 15, 2020Assignee: SAMSUNG DISPLAY CO., LTD.Inventors: Oh June Kwon, Seung Wook Kwon, Hyo Jeong Kwon, Doo Hwan Kim, Min Sang Kim, Chan Ho Moon, Won Je Cho
